MORRIS TUBE SHOOTING.
«, The following is a list of prize-winners of the AmbcrCey Morris Tube Chib for the reason just raded. —Mr Mi_g!ey*s trophy, W. Holton: Dr. Cook's trophy, R. Stevenson; Mr Wooler's trophy, S. Frew; M_ Mitchell's trophy, Dr. Ccok; Mr Burland's trophy, H. Mason. Club trophies were won by the following:—Mess-s T. Chamberlain, J. Byrch, B. Turner. J. F. Mason, and VT. H Rhodes, junr. The lady's bracelet was; won by Mr Luisetti. while the cup for the best average was gained by R. Stevenson.
